Русская поддержка интернет-магазина PrestaShop
русская поддержка PrestaShop.
Регистрация
Забыли пароль?
Главная
Возможности
Демо
Скачать
Каталог магазинов
Форум
Модули и шаблоны
Администрирование
Реклама и маркетинг
Аналитика и статистика
Оплата и платежные системы
Управление контентом
Экспорт
Фронт-офис
Локализация
Торговые площадки
Управление товарами
Средства миграции
Оформление заказа
Поиск и фильтры
Доставка и логистика
Слайд-шоу
Социальные сети
Модификаторы
Шаблоны PrestaShop
Работа
Главная
Форум
Общие форумы (prestashop v1.5.x)
Общий форум
Категории главного меню.
Категории главного меню.
edal
Новичок
Сообщений: 10
Откуда: Москва
Регистрация: 24-06-2013
# 1
24-07-2013 14:05
Добрый день. Есть сайт
http://estet-kamin.ru/
. Там есть вертикальное меню слева. Можно ли как то сделать так, что бы перед каждым словом в категории "Камины", "Печи" и т.д. стояли иконки этих категорий? Второй день мучаюсь не как не могу найти. Могу поставить на все категории одну иконку, а надо разные.
Сообщение отредактировано edal 24-07-2013 15:09 ...
pav31
Профессионал
Сообщений: 418
Откуда: Киев
Регистрация: 28-09-2011
# 2
24-07-2013 14:16
Для этого нужно вносить изменения в сам модуль вертикального меню, выводить пути изображений категорий в модуле
Разработка магазинов на prestashop
, модули prestashop.
edal
Новичок
Сообщений: 10
Откуда: Москва
Регистрация: 24-06-2013
# 3
24-07-2013 14:22
а вот куда вставить все это дело(
pav31
Профессионал
Сообщений: 418
Откуда: Киев
Регистрация: 28-09-2011
# 4
24-07-2013 14:43
blockslidingcategories, вносить изменения в код и в файл шаблона модуля
Разработка магазинов на prestashop
, модули prestashop.
leonetrek
Новичок
Сообщений: 70
Регистрация: 17-10-2012
# 5
27-07-2013 04:09
Это просто. Вот пример сайта, где я это сделал:
http://opticspace.com.ua/
Для этого нужно сделать следующее:
Править надо этот файл: category-tree-branch.tpl в модулях. Модуль:blockcategories. Точно не помню как выглядит оригинал самого шаблона, но вот так он выглядит у меня:
Код:
<li {if isset($last) && $last == 'true'}class="last"{/if}>
<
a href
="
{$node.link|escape:'htmlall':'UTF-8'}
" {if isset($currentCategoryId) && $node.id == $currentCategoryId}class="
selected"{/if}><
img src
="/img/c/{$node.id}-small_default.jpg
" alt="
{$node.desc}
" id="
categoryImage
" />
<
div class
="
catleft
">{$node.name}<
/div
>
<
/a
>
{if $node.children|@count > 0}
<
ul
>
{foreach from=$node.children item=child name=categoryTreeBranch}
{if $smarty.foreach.categoryTreeBranch.last}
{include file="
$branche_tpl_path
" node=$child last='true'}
{else}
{include file="
$branche_tpl_path
" node=$child last='false'}
{/if}
{/foreach}
<
/ul
>
{/if}
<
/li
>
Ну и потом в css подгони как нравится
На Главную форума
Найти
FaQ
Панель управления
Кто он-лайн
Общие форумы (prestashop v1.7.x)
-- Общий форум
-- Установка, Настройка, Обновление
-- Модули, плагины
-- Дизайн, шаблоны
-- Песочница
Общие форумы (prestashop v1.6.x)
-- Общий форум
-- Установка, Настройка, Обновление
-- Модули, плагины
-- Дизайн, шаблоны
-- Песочница
Общие форумы (prestashop v1.5.x)
-- Общий форум
Общие форумы (prestashop v1.4.x)
-- Новости и объявления
-- Общий форум
-- Установка, Настройка, Обновление
-- Дизайн, шаблоны
-- Модули, плагины
-- Песочница
-- Прочее
Общие форумы (prestashop v1.3.x)
-- Общий форум
-- Установка, Настройка, Обновление
-- Дизайн, шаблоны
-- Модули, плагины
---- Платные модули и хаки
-- Песочница
Другое
-- Корзина
---- Хостинг
---- Каталог магазинов
---- Общий форум
---- Прием багов